If you are going to buy a new graphics card and are choosing between Quadro M5000M and Radeon R5 Bristol Ridge, there are a couple of things to consider. Cards with more VRAM in general perform better and allow you to play on higher graphics settings. Size also makes a difference. A model with a large heatsink can occupy up to three expansion slots on a motherboard. Be sure you have enough room in your PC case. When comparing GPUs with different architectures, more processing cores and even higher TFLOPS will not always translate to better performance. Quadro M5000M and Radeon R5 Bristol Ridge are Laptop Graphics Cards
Note: Quadro M5000M and Radeon R5 Bristol Ridge are only used in laptop graphics. They have lower GPU clock speed compared to the desktop variant, which results in lower power consumption, but also 10-30% lower gaming performance. Quadro M5000M has 733% more power consumption, than Radeon R5 Bristol Ridge.
Quadro M5000M is used in Mobile workstations, and Radeon R5 Bristol Ridge - in Laptops.
Quadro M5000M is build with Maxwell architecture, and Radeon R5 Bristol Ridge - with GCN 1.2/2.0.
Quadro M5000M and Radeon R5 Bristol Ridge are manufactured by 28 nm process technology.
